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,351,843,472
Lastest Block:
2,009,753
Utxos:
1,982,581
Nodes:
318
OmniXEP Contracts:
281
Block details
[STAKE]
04/01/2026 23:47:12 UTC
Txid
cd9003894a0dc17d3df07e53001e57ba8b497792c6d49cc83a8c1050824623cc
Block
1,982,295
Block hash
f9edd0c1375525a4fa2422d77f5cc1ccd5a50db5f24e1e6cd47b177fc9b0a432
Stake amount
115.21282087 XEP
Sender
ep1qdp3yq56wnlp40t93hpq2ttqd7tv6upx50rkxkn
Recipient
ep1qdp3yq56wnlp40t93hpq2ttqd7tv6upx50rkxkn
(1,975,215.81432254 XEP)